    I would like to summarize all changes.

    1. integrate with google search engine - there was a encoding issue when page was translated. how to fix?

    -go to admincp->style & templates->navbar template
    -in this template find:
    PHP Code:
    <input type="hidden" name="ie" value="ISO-8859-2"/> 
    - and replace with:
    PHP Code:
    <input type="hidden" name="ie"<vb:if condition="$_REQUEST['language']"value="UTF-8"<vb:else />value="ISO-8859-2"</vb:if>/> 
    2. issue with german letters in url on not translated page -> we should define character replacement in vbseo general options.

    EXAMPLE:
    Code:
    'ü' => 'ue'
    'ä' => 'ae'
    'ö' => 'oe'
    'ß' => 'ss'
    3. about translation of main page - still working.
